Stefano Stabellini writes:

> Improve early_print_info to also print the banks saved in
> bootinfo.reserved_mem. Print them right after RESVD, increasing the same
> index.
>
> Since we are at it, also switch the existing RESVD print to use unsigned
> int.
>
> Signed-off-by: Stefano Stabellini <stefanos@xilinx.com>
Reviewed-by: Volodymyr Babchuk <volodymyr.babchuk@epam.com>

But, please see NIT below.

> ---
> Changes in v5:
> - switch to unsigned
>
> Changes in v4:
> - new patch
> ---
>  xen/arch/arm/bootfdt.c | 11 +++++++++--
>  1 file changed, 9 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
>
> diff --git a/xen/arch/arm/bootfdt.c b/xen/arch/arm/bootfdt.c
> index 0b0e22a3d0..32153e6207 100644
> --- a/xen/arch/arm/bootfdt.c
> +++ b/xen/arch/arm/bootfdt.c
> @@ -337,9 +337,10 @@ static int __init early_scan_node(const void *fdt,
>  static void __init early_print_info(void)
>  {
>      struct meminfo *mi = &bootinfo.mem;
> +    struct meminfo *mem_resv = &bootinfo.reserved_mem;
>      struct bootmodules *mods = &bootinfo.modules;
>      struct bootcmdlines *cmds = &bootinfo.cmdlines;
> -    int i, nr_rsvd;
> +    unsigned int i, j, nr_rsvd;
>  
>      for ( i = 0; i < mi->nr_banks; i++ )
>          printk("RAM: %"PRIpaddr" - %"PRIpaddr"\n",
> @@ -361,9 +362,15 @@ static void __init early_print_info(void)
>              continue;
>          /* fdt_get_mem_rsv returns length */
>          e += s;
> -        printk(" RESVD[%d]: %"PRIpaddr" - %"PRIpaddr"\n",
> +        printk(" RESVD[%u]: %"PRIpaddr" - %"PRIpaddr"\n",
>                       i, s, e);
NIT: I see no reason, why this printk is split into two lines, as nicely fits
into one line.

>      }
> +    for ( j = 0; j < mem_resv->nr_banks; j++, i++ )
> +    {
> +        printk(" RESVD[%u]: %"PRIpaddr" - %"PRIpaddr"\n", i,
> +                     mem_resv->bank[j].start,
> +                     mem_resv->bank[j].start + mem_resv->bank[j].size - 1);
> +    }
>      printk("\n");
>      for ( i = 0 ; i < cmds->nr_mods; i++ )
>          printk("CMDLINE[%"PRIpaddr"]:%s %s\n", cmds->cmdline[i].start,
